Облака точек — это удивительный способ визуализации данных, который позволяет наглядно представить отношения и распределение значений. Они широко используются в научных исследованиях, маркетинге, географии и многих других областях. Однако, создание облака точек может показаться сложной задачей для новичков.
В этом пошаговом руководстве я предоставлю вам все необходимые инструкции и советы по созданию вашего собственного облака точек. Сначала я расскажу о том, что такое облако точек и как оно работает. Затем я поделюсь с вами самыми эффективными инструментами и программами для создания облака точек.
Приступая к созданию облака точек, важно иметь базовое понимание статистики и данных. Мы обсудим основные понятия, такие как переменные и данные, а также способы сбора и представления информации. Основные шаги процесса создания облака точек будут рассмотрены детально и наглядно.
Не беспокойтесь, если вы не имеете опыта в программировании или обработке данных. Я постараюсь объяснить все шаги простым и понятным языком. После прочтения этой статьи вы будете готовы создать свое первое облако точек и удивиться его красоте и информативности!
Первый шаг
Для создания облака точек вам понадобятся:
- Компьютер с установленным программным обеспечением для работы с графикой. Это может быть любой графический редактор, такой как Photoshop, Illustrator или GIMP.
- Изображение или фотография, на основе которой вы хотели бы создать облако точек. Вы можете выбрать любую картинку или фото. Однако рекомендуется использовать изображения с хорошим контрастом и яркостью, чтобы точки были хорошо видны.
- Доступ к интернету. Для создания облака точек вам понадобятся онлайн-инструменты или информация, которую вы можете найти в Интернете.
Также рекомендуется иметь некоторые базовые навыки работы с графическими редакторами, такие как изменение размера изображения, выбор цвета точек и т. д.
Теперь, когда у вас есть все необходимые материалы и инструменты, вы готовы перейти ко второму шагу — выбору подходящего метода создания облака точек.
Второй шаг
После того, как вы установили необходимые программы и настроили среду разработки, вы готовы приступить к созданию облака точек. Вторым шагом будет получение данных, которые будут использоваться для построения облака точек.
Изначально данные можно получить с помощью готовых наборов данных, которые доступны онлайн. Например, можно воспользоваться открытыми базами данных или использовать сторонние источники данных.
Также вы можете собирать свои собственные данные, например, с помощью специализированных датчиков или устройств сбора данных. Это может быть полезно, если вам требуется собрать данные, специфичные для вашего проекта или исследования.
После того, как вы получили данные, следующим шагом будет их обработка и форматирование. Вы можете использовать различные инструменты и библиотеки для анализа и преобразования данных, чтобы они были готовы для использования в создании облака точек.
В этом разделе мы рассмотрели второй шаг процесса создания облака точек – получение и подготовку данных. В следующем разделе мы поговорим о третьем шаге – создании самого облака точек.
Практическое руководство по созданию облака точек
Для создания облака точек, вам понадобятся следующие инструменты:
- Язык программирования Python.
- Библиотека для работы с графиками, например Matplotlib.
- Данные, которые хотите визуализировать в виде облака точек.
Первым шагом является установка Python и необходимых библиотек. Вы можете сделать это, следуя инструкциям на официальных сайтах Python и Matplotlib. После установки запустите среду разработки Python и создайте новый проект.
Вторым шагом является загрузка данных. Если у вас уже есть данные, вы можете пропустить этот шаг. В противном случае вы можете использовать искусственно сгенерированные данные или найти открытые данные в Интернете.
Третьим шагом является написание кода для создания облака точек. Вначале вам необходимо импортировать необходимые библиотеки:
import matplotlib.pyplot as plt
import numpy as np
Затем создайте массивы с данными для оси x и оси y:
x = np.random.rand(100) # случайные значения для оси x
y = np.random.rand(100) # случайные значения для оси y
Наконец, построим облако точек с помощью функции scatter:
plt.scatter(x, y)
plt.xlabel('X-axis')
plt.ylabel('Y-axis')
plt.title('Cloud of Points')
plt.show()
Запустите код и вы увидете созданное облако точек на графике. Вы можете настроить внешний вид облака точек, изменяя параметры функции scatter, такие как цвет, размер точек и т.д.
Вот и все! Теперь вы знаете, как создать облако точек с помощью Python и Matplotlib. Этот метод может быть очень полезным для анализа и визуализации данных в различных областях, таких как машинное обучение, биология и финансы.
Третий шаг
После определения координат точек и их характеристик, необходимо создать таблицу с этими данными. Для этого используем тег <table>.
Начнем с открытия тега <table> и его атрибутов:
<table> |
После этого нужно создать строки (тег <tr>) таблицы и внутри них ячейки (тег <td>). В ячейки будем вставлять значения координат и характеристик точек. После каждой строки и ячейки нужно закрывать соответствующие теги.
Пример кода для создания таблицы с координатами и характеристиками точек:
Точка 1 | x: 0 | y: 0 | size: 5 | color: blue |
Точка 2 | x: 10 | y: 5 | size: 10 | color: red |
Точка 3 | x: -5 | y: 8 | size: 7 | color: green |
Закрываем таблицу с помощью тега </table>:
</table> |
Таким образом, мы создали таблицу с координатами и характеристиками точек. Теперь можно переходить к следующему шагу — отображению облака точек на веб-странице.
Четвертый шаг
Теперь, когда вы создали файл с данными, вам нужно добавить его в код HTML. Чтобы создать облако точек, мы будем использовать тег <canvas>
.
Перед тем как приступить к кодированию, убедитесь, что у вас уже есть заготовка разметки HTML с тегом <canvas>
. Если у вас нет такого файла, создайте его в своем редакторе кода.
Вставьте следующий код перед закрывающим тегом </body>
:
<canvas id="myCanvas" width="800" height="400"></canvas>
Здесь мы создали элемент с идентификатором myCanvas
и задали для него размеры 800 пикселей по ширине и 400 пикселей по высоте. Это будет область, в которой будет отображаться наше облако точек.
Теперь, когда у нас есть пустой элемент <canvas>
, продолжим с кодированием.
Вставьте следующий код после тега <canvas>
:
<script>
var canvas = document.getElementById('myCanvas');
var ctx = canvas.getContext('2d');
var points = [
{ x: 100, y: 50 },
{ x: 200, y: 100 },
{ x: 300, y: 200 },
{ x: 400, y: 300 },
{ x: 500, y: 350 }
];
ctx.fillStyle = 'black';
points.forEach(function(point) {
ctx.beginPath();
ctx.arc(point.x, point.y, 5, 0, 2 * Math.PI);
ctx.fill();
});
</script>
В этом коде мы создали переменные canvas
и ctx
, которые получают элемент <canvas>
и его контекст рисования, соответственно. Затем мы создали массив points
, который содержит координаты каждой точки в нашем облаке.
С помощью цикла forEach
мы проходимся по каждой точке и рисуем ее с помощью методов контекста рисования ctx.arc()
и ctx.fill()
. Мы задали радиус точки 5 пикселей и цвет заливки черный.
Сохраните файл и откройте его в браузере. Вы должны увидеть облако из пяти черных точек.
Мы успешно завершили четвертый шаг создания облака точек! Теперь мы должны перейти к следующему шагу, чтобы добавить стили и сделать наше облако точек более привлекательным.